The question
The country of Kestrel produces only two goods, industrial machinery and processed food, and is currently producing on its production possibilities curve. Kestrel's engineers develop an automation technology that raises output per worker in both of its industries. Assume the size of Kestrel's labor force and its stock of natural resources are unchanged. Show the effect of this change on Kestrel's production possibilities curve. Automation Lifts Both Industries: the worked answer
On the Production Possibilities graph, The PPC frontier shifts outward.
Why The PPC frontier shifts outward
Technology is one of the determinants of an economy's productive capacity. An automation technology that raises output per worker in both industries lets Kestrel produce more of each good using the resources it already has, so the maximum attainable quantity of both goods increases and the entire frontier shifts outward. The labor force and the stock of natural resources are unchanged, so the gain comes entirely from getting more output out of the same resources rather than from acquiring new ones.
What happens to the equilibrium
Kestrel's maximum attainable output of both goods rises, and combinations that were previously unattainable can now be produced.
The mistake students make on this one
A tempting wrong answer moves the curve inward, on the reasoning that automation replaces workers and leaves the country producing less. Automation here shrinks no resource: the labor force is stated to be unchanged, and each worker now produces more, so the maximum output of both goods is larger and the curve moves outward, not inward.
On exam day
Count the industries the improvement reaches before you draw: a gain confined to one industry rotates the frontier outward along that good's axis alone, while a gain in both industries moves the entire curve outward.
